新人上路,一来向大家问好,二来有问题想讨教大家,希望各位多多帮忙 我有一段数控等离子切割机的切割指令,想通过它反向编译成cad文件,在此过程中遇到一些问题讨教 1.轻质多义线动态数组:我不知为何多义线数组老是下标出界,(详见我的程序说明) 2.我将多义线生成写成一个子程序,在主程序中调用也总是无效的过程和参数 请大家指导指导! ---------------------------------------------------------- 以下是部分划线指令及坐标 ----------------------------------------------------------- % O0857 G92 x 0 y 0 绝对坐标归0,0 G91 相对坐标开始 G21 M11 划线程序开始 G00 x 359.98 y 464.15 快速移动到X,Y M09 划线开始 G01 x -50.00 y 0.00 直线 G01 x 0.00 y 1072.48 G01 x 30.00 y 40.00 G01 x -30.00 y 40.00 G01 x 0.02 y 1072.48 G01 x 50.00 y 0.00 M10 划线结束 G00 x 1488.99 y 252.45 。。。。。。。 此处省略一些 M09 G03 x 140.00 y -140.00 i 140.00 j 0.00 G01 x 500.00 y 0.00 G03 x 140.00 y 140.00 i 0.00 j 140.00 G01 x 0.00 y 1300.00 G03 x -140.00 y 140.00 i -140.00 j 0.00 G01 x -500.00 y 0.00 G03 x -140.00 y -140.00 i 0.00 j -140.00 G01 x 0.00 y -1290.00 M10 G00 x -2768.99 y -1127.89 M12 M00 G00 x 12.26 y 9.56 |